The Milwaukee 49-22-0130 Contractor's Selfeed Bit Kit is a 7-piece selfeed drill bit kit built for drilling large, clean holes in wood for pipe and conduit installation. This is a drill bit kit designed for repetitive large-diameter wood boring. Model Number: 49-22-0130. If you do rough-in work and need common selfeed sizes in one case, this kit is set up to save time instead of having you piece together sizes one by one.
Milwaukee built this set around the sizes contractors actually reach for on the job: 1 inch, 1-1/8 inch, 1-1/4 inch, 1-1/2 inch, 1-3/4 inch, 2-1/8 inch, and 2-9/16 inch. The center feed screw pilots each bit and helps pull it through the material, which reduces the amount of force needed from the user. In real work, that means less fighting the drill when boring repeated holes in clean wood framing and more consistent hole quality from start to finish.
The inside cutting plane is there for a reason. It shaves the hole radius for smooth, clean results instead of tearing through the material. That matters when you are running conduit, pipe, or other rough-in components through framing and want a predictable hole without ragged edges. Milwaukee also calls out improved balance with reduced runout, which helps the bit track cleaner and feel more controlled in the drill.
On the durability side, this kit is made for repeat use rather than one-and-done jobs. The bits are resharpenable, and Milwaukee includes two removable, replaceable feed screws. Every bit is coated with a rust inhibitor as well. If your bits live in a truck, gang box, or jobsite case, that extra protection matters more than it sounds on paper.
The included hardware makes the set more useful than a pile of loose bits. You get a 5-1/2 inch one-piece shank and coupling plus an extension for added reach in tighter spaces. Based on the product images and manufacturer details, the system uses a 7/16 inch hex shank format that fits 7/16 inch chucks and extensions, and Milwaukee shows it for use with Super Hawg, Hole Hawg, and drill products with a minimum 1/2 inch chuck size required. That gives the kit clear compatibility with heavy-duty drilling setups used in rough carpentry, plumbing, and electrical work.
The carrying case is not filler. Large selfeed bits are awkward to store and easy to damage when they roll around loose. Keeping the full set organized in one impact resistant case helps protect the cutting edges, keeps the shank and extension together, and makes it easier to bring the full range of sizes to the work area.

Pro Tip
Use the extension when you need reach between studs or around existing rough-in, but keep the bit started square before you let the feed screw pull. That gives you a cleaner entry and keeps a large selfeed bit from wandering at the start of the cut.

Common Questions
- What material is this kit designed to cut? Milwaukee identifies these selfeed bits as ideal for clean wood.
- What chuck size do I need? The manufacturer states a minimum 1/2 in. drill chuck size is required.
- What shank size do these bits use? The bits use a 7/16 in. hex shank that fits 7/16 in. chucks and extensions.
- Can the bits be maintained instead of replaced right away? Yes. Milwaukee states the bits are resharpenable and include removable, replaceable feed screws.
